NPC Robbery is a fast, configurable criminal resource that lets players hold up ambient pedestrians for cash and items instead of relying on a stale free-aim system. It turns quiet streets into unpredictable opportunities, giving low-level criminals an accessible way to earn while adding real risk to every encounter.

The script is built around clean interaction and server-side validation, so rewards and cooldowns stay under your control. Players approach the nearest ped, trigger the robbery, and work through a short challenge before pocketing whatever the victim was carrying, all while the world reacts believably around them.

How the NPC Robbery flow works

  • Target the closest pedestrian with a key press or a simple command.
  • Optional skill-check minigame that rewards timing and punishes mistakes.
  • Progress bar and synced animations that sell the hold-up convincingly.
  • Configurable cash and item payouts pulled from your own reward tables.
  • Per-player cooldown that prevents spam and keeps the economy balanced.

Systems that keep robberies fair

  • Automatic police dispatch alerts with street lookup and map blips.
  • Escalating NPC reactions so victims can flee or call for help.
  • Server-authoritative reward handling that blocks common exploits.
  • Inventory support for popular systems, dropping loot straight into bags.
  • Fully editable config for chances, cooldowns, and reward ranges.

Because every payout is validated on the server, cheaters cannot inflate their earnings or bypass the cooldown, which keeps your economy healthy even on high-population servers. The dispatch integration gives police meaningful work, turning simple street crime into dynamic cops-and-robbers gameplay.

Setup is straightforward, with a single configuration file exposing the values most owners want to tune. You can raise the difficulty for hardcore servers or soften it for casual communities, and the optional minigame can be disabled entirely if you prefer a pure chance roll.
